&lt;div&gt;&amp;lt;br&amp;gt;People with an endomorph body type tend to have a slow metabolism, making it easier to gain weight and harder to lose it. An endomorph diet and exercise plan can help with meeting and maintaining health goals. People with an endomorph body type usually have soft, round bodies with a wide waist and large bones, joints, and hips, regardless of their height. This article covers what an endomorph body type and diet is. We also discuss exercises that may help people with endomorphic bodies lose weight and build muscle. What is the endomorph body type? In the 1940s, psychologist William Sheldon described three main body types, or somatotypes: ectomorphic, mesomorphic, and endomorphic. People with an endomorphic body may have characteristics and traits that make it difficult for  Click here them to diet, gain muscle mass, and exercise. They also tend to have a slower metabolism, possibly due to their more substantial build.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Having a slower metabolism can mean that the body is more likely to convert excess calories into fat. According to Sheldon, following diet and exercise plans may be [https://elearnportal.science/wiki/User:Abdul086949 Read more] challenging for endomorph body types. For example, they may have a general desire for food, comfort, and relaxation and be more prone to sedentarism. Therefore, people with endomorphic bodies may need to more carefully control what they eat, when they eat, and how much they eat. What is the endomorph diet? Sources differ on what the best endomorph diet plan is. Generally, people with endomorphic bodies may benefit from a paleo-like diet where each meal contains protein, vegetables, and some healthy fats. The paleo diet, also known as the Stone Age diet, is an eating plan that mimics how prehistoric humans may have eaten. According to the American Council on Exercise (ACE), people with an endomorph body type tend to be more sensitive to carbohydrates and insulin.&amp;lt;br&amp;gt;[https://ejje.weblio.jp/sentence/content/see weblio.jp]&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Insulin is a hormone that allows blood sugars to enter cells. So, people following an endomorph diet may wish to limit or avoid carbohydrate-dense foods, especially refined carbohydrates such as white flour and sugar. These foods release sugars rapidly into the bloodstream, causing blood sugar spikes and dips. The body is also more likely to turn these sugars into fat than burn them as energy. Due to their slow metabolism, endomorphic bodies are also more likely to convert excess calories into fat. For this same reason, people following an endomorph diet may want to avoid foods that are generally calorie dense but nutrient poor. Exercise is an important part of any weight loss plan, especially for people with an endomorph body type. Exercising helps increase metabolism and reduce fat. &lt;div&gt;&amp;lt;br&amp;gt;Human ingenuity is limitless. The list of creative and brilliant inventors throughout human history is long and each story is fascinating. Some have achieved legendary status. People like Thomas Edison, Nikola Tesla and  [http://47.105.105.181/connie41683855 http://47.105.105.181/connie41683855] Alexander Graham Bell helped shape our world through inventiveness. There are other stories about inventors who, working independently, created inventions nearly identical to one another at around the same time. Did Philo Farnsworth or Vladimir Zworykin invent the first electronic television? Legally, the honor goes to Farnsworth but the debate continues to this day. But there are other inventions that don&amp;#039;t have quite the same impact on our way of life. Some of these inventions may seem unusual or even ridiculous. Many fade into obscurity almost immediately after they appear. A few have lasting power and succeed despite -- or perhaps even because of -- the ridicule they receive from the public. Our first entry was a mistake and owes its origins to a very serious matter. In 1943,  [http://ww.mallangpeach.com/bbs/board.php?bo_table=free&amp;amp;wr_id=1529998 www.PrimeBoosts.com] General Electric engineer James Wright was working on developing synthetic rubber.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;As World War II raged, the Allied countries faced shortages of rubber from natural sources. Wright&amp;#039;s experiments resulted in something that wasn&amp;#039;t nearly as useful as rubber but would become a popular toy: Silly Putty. Wright made Silly Putty from silicone oil and boric acid. He dropped some and saw it bounce. Over the next two years, General Electric sent samples of Wright&amp;#039;s putty to other engineers but no one could figure out a way to use it in a practical application. By 1949, a toy shop owner got her hands on the stuff and immediately saw that it could be used for entertainment rather than industry. A marketing consultant sunk money into it and nearly went bankrupt before a newspaper story in 1950 created a huge demand for the product. It&amp;#039;s been available ever since, bouncing on floors and picking up newsprint for decades. &lt;div&gt;&amp;lt;br&amp;gt;How Does Creatine Supplement Work? How Safe Is Creatine? Creatine is a compound you naturally have in your body. It is an amino acid that comes from other amino acids your body uses to build proteins. You&amp;#039;ll find it in your muscles. But it&amp;#039;s mostly there in a different form called phosphocreatine or creatine phosphate. Phosphocreatine helps you make adenosine triphosphate (ATP), which is a source of energy your muscle cells need when you&amp;#039;re active. So creatine in your muscles normally is a supply for the energy you&amp;#039;ll need during exercise. Creatine is in your brain, too. Other organs in your body also make creatine in tiny amounts each day. These include your liver, pancreas, and kidneys. Because creatine is an amino acid, you can get it from foods, such as meat and seafood. If you&amp;#039;ve seen creatine written as creatinine, that&amp;#039;s not just a typo.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Creatinine is the name of a chemical byproduct of creatine. When creatine in your body is broken down, it makes creatinine. You can find creatinine in your muscles, blood, and pee. How Does Creatine Supplement Work? When you take creatine, most of it will end up in your muscles. Your muscles will change it into phosphocreatine by adding phosphoric acid to it. By taking a creatine supplement, such as creatine monohydrate, you can change the amount of phosphocreatine and creatine in your muscles. The extra creatine can help your muscles make more ATP faster as you use it to fuel your cells during high-intensity exercise. One reason your body builds more lean muscle tissue when you take creatine is that your muscles will hold more water. The pressure from the water in your cells causes your muscles to swell. This water and swelling can also make cells grow. Is creatine a steroid?&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;No. Creatine is not a steroid. &lt;div&gt;&amp;lt;br&amp;gt;The muscular system is an organ system consisting of skeletal, smooth, and cardiac muscle. It permits movement of the body, maintains posture, and circulates blood throughout the body. The muscular systems in vertebrates are controlled through the nervous system although some muscles (such as the cardiac muscle) can be completely autonomous. Together with the skeletal system in the human, it forms the musculoskeletal system, which is responsible for the movement of the body. There are three distinct types of muscle: skeletal muscle, cardiac or heart muscle, and smooth (non-striated) muscle. Muscles provide strength, balance, posture, movement,  [https://git.siin.space/quinngibson007/prime-boosts-pills2001/wiki/8-Signs-and-Symptoms-of-Protein-Deficiency git.siin.space] and heat for the body to keep warm. There are more than 600 muscles in an adult male human body. A kind of elastic tissue makes up each muscle, which consists of thousands, or tens of thousands, of small muscle fibers. Each fiber comprises many tiny strands called fibrils, impulses from nerve cells control the contraction of each muscle fiber.&amp;lt;br&amp;gt;[https://bmjopen.bmj.com/content/5/4/e006577 bmj.com]&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Skeletal muscle, is a type of striated muscle, composed of muscle cells, called muscle fibers, which are in turn composed of myofibrils. Myofibrils are composed of sarcomeres, the basic building blocks of striated muscle tissue. Upon stimulation by an action potential, skeletal muscles perform a coordinated contraction by shortening each sarcomere. The best proposed model for understanding contraction is the sliding filament model of muscle contraction. Within the sarcomere, actin and myosin fibers overlap in a contractile motion towards each other. The myosin heads move in a coordinated style; they swivel toward the center of the sarcomere, detach, and then reattach to the nearest active site of the actin filament. This is called a ratchet-type drive system. This process consumes large amounts of adenosine triphosphate (ATP), the energy source of the cell. ATP binds to the cross-bridges between myosin heads and actin filaments. The release of energy powers the swiveling of the myosin head. When ATP is used, it becomes adenosine diphosphate (ADP), and  [http://inprokorea.com/bbs/board.php?bo_table=free&amp;amp;wr_id=2126374 PrimeBoosts.com] since muscles store little ATP, they must continuously replace the discharged ADP with ATP.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Muscle tissue also contains a stored supply of a fast-acting recharge chemical, creatine phosphate, which when necessary can assist with the rapid regeneration of ADP into ATP. Calcium ions are required for each cycle of the sarcomere. Calcium is released from the sarcoplasmic reticulum into the sarcomere when a muscle is stimulated to contract. This calcium uncovers the actin-binding sites. When the muscle no longer needs to contract, the calcium ions are pumped from the sarcomere and back into storage in the sarcoplasmic reticulum. There are approximately 639 skeletal muscles in the human body. Heart muscle is striated muscle but is distinct from skeletal muscle because the muscle fibers are laterally connected. Furthermore, just as with smooth muscles, their movement is involuntary. Heart muscle is controlled by the sinus node influenced by the autonomic nervous system. Smooth muscle contraction is regulated by the autonomic nervous system, hormones, and local chemical signals, allowing for gradual and sustained contractions. This type of muscle tissue is also capable of adapting to different levels of stretch and tension, which is important for maintaining proper blood flow and the movement of materials through the digestive system.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Neuromuscular junctions are the focal point where a motor neuron attaches to a muscle. Acetylcholine, (a neurotransmitter used in skeletal muscle contraction) is released from the axon terminal of the nerve cell when an action potential reaches the microscopic junction called a synapse. A group of chemical messengers across the synapse and stimulate the formation of electrical changes, which are produced in the muscle cell when the acetylcholine binds to receptors on its surface. Calcium is released from its storage area in the cell&amp;#039;s sarcoplasmic reticulum. An impulse from a nerve cell causes calcium release and brings about a single, short muscle contraction called a muscle twitch. If there is a problem at the neuromuscular junction, a very prolonged contraction may occur, such as the muscle contractions that result from tetanus. Also, a loss of function at the junction can produce paralysis. Skeletal muscles are organized into hundreds of motor units, each of which involves a motor neuron, attached by a series of thin finger-like structures called axon terminals.&amp;lt;br&amp;gt;&lt;/div&gt;</summary>

&lt;div&gt;&amp;lt;br&amp;gt;The king brown snake is a venomous predator with various behaviors adapted for hunting, defense and reproduction. Their climbing ability, feeding habits and territorial tendencies make them unique among snake species in Australia, where they&amp;#039;ve carved out a serious reputation as one of the most dangerous serpents in the country. Despite their large size and venomous nature, king browns are not typically aggressive toward humans unless they feel provoked or threatened. But how did this humble black snake species acquire such a regal name? How Big Are King Brown Snakes? Is the King Brown Snake Venomous? The king brown snake, scientifically known as Pseudechis australis, belongs to the Elapidae family, which includes venomous snakes like cobras and mambas. This species is part of the black snake genus Pseudechis and is known for its potent venom and robust build. The name &amp;quot;king brown&amp;quot; comes from its large size and brownish hue, but the species is actually more closely related to black snakes than brown snakes (genus Pseudonaja).&amp;lt;br&amp;gt;[http://www.nzlii.org/nzlii/disclaimers.html nzlii.org]&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Despite [https://waselplatform.org/blog/index.php?entryid=329952 This product], the name has persisted in popular usage. Mulga is a small tree or shrub from the Acacia aneura, native to Australia. It is particularly widespread in arid and semi-arid regions. This plant forms part of the distinctive woodland ecosystem known as mulga woodlands, characterized by dense, low-lying vegetation, which offers mulga snakes shelter and an abundance of prey. King browns rank among the larger snake species in Australia; they typically measure around 8 feet (about 2.5 meters) in length, but some can grow to nearly 10 feet (3 meters), the maximum recorded length. That said, their size can vary based on their geographic location and the environmental conditions of their habitat. Snakes in more arid regions are often larger than those in temperate areas. When they hatch from their eggs, they are pretty small, typically measuring around 9 inches (22.9 centimeters) in length. As they grow, the species undergoes a significant growth spurt.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;They continue to feed on small prey items, such as insects and  [http://shinhwaspodium.com/bbs/board.php?bo_table=free&amp;amp;wr_id=4243530 Prime Boosts Supplement] small reptiles, which provides them with the necessary nutrients to develop and increase in size. It usually takes several years for them to reach their full adult size. Like many other snake species, this serpent has specialized heat-sensing pits on its smooth snout. These pits help them detect warm-blooded animals by picking up faint infrared radiation emitted by their bodies, which aids them in hunting for food, particularly at night. They also have flexible jaws, which allow them to consume prey much larger than their head by unhinging their lower jaw and stretching their mouth around their meal. This ability is crucial for their survival, given the size and variety of the prey they consume. These dangerous snakes bask in the sun to warm up and  [https://marketingme.wiki/wiki/User:FrancescoPhy Prime Boosts Supplement] seek shade or burrows to cool down. A particularly remarkable feature is its resistance to the venom of other snakes.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;This adaptation allows the robust snake to prey on and consume other venomous snakes without suffering the toxic effects that would be lethal to most other creatures. That&amp;#039;s why they thrive throughout the deserts and arid regions of central, northern and western Australia - their native range. The snake is prevalent in the Northern Territory and also found in the arid and semi-arid regions of South Australia, as well as central and western Queensland. The king brown is highly adaptable and can live comfortably in grasslands, scrublands and woodlands. This adaptability even allows it to thrive in areas impacted by human activities. However, its presence diminishes in the cooler southern regions of Australia, and it is notably absent from the island of Tasmania. Yes, the king brown is one of the most venomous snakes in Australia and is known for its potent venom. While its venom is highly toxic, it is less lethal than other Australian snakes, like the inland taipan or eastern brown snake.&amp;lt;br&amp;gt;&lt;/div&gt;</summary>

&lt;div&gt;&amp;lt;br&amp;gt;The redback spider (Latrodectus hasselti) is one of Australia&amp;#039;s most iconic arachnids. It&amp;#039;s a member of the widow spider family, closely related to the black widow spider. They&amp;#039;re famous for their distinctive red markings and potent venom. While redback spider bites can cause pain, advances in antivenom treatment have made these encounters much less dangerous. But it&amp;#039;s definitely a spider that humans should avoid. Where Are Redback Spiders Commonly Found? What Attracts and Deters Redback Spiders? These are tiny spiders. Female redback spiders are about 0.4 inches (10 mm), while male redback spiders are much smaller, only about 0.11 to 0.16 inches (3 to 4 mm). Female redback spiders are easy to identify by their shiny black bodies, slender legs and iconic red stripe running down their abdomen. In some cases, this stripe may be broken or absent, but most females sport something similar to the vivid red hourglass you&amp;#039;ll find on black widows. Young spiders resemble males in coloration until they mature.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;The redback is often mistaken for its cousin, the black widow, but the Southern Hemisphere cousin is smaller. Are Redback Spiders Dangerous? Yes, Australian redback spiders are dangerous. Redback spider venom contains neurotoxins that can cause severe pain, sweating and systemic symptoms such as nausea and muscle spasms. Redback bites are more commonly inflicted by a female redback, as the male redback spiders rarely bite humans. Luckily, antivenom treatment for redback spider bites has been available since the 1950s, significantly reducing the risk of severe complications. Fatalities are now extremely rare. However, bites should always be treated promptly. The redback spider is native to Australia but has also become an invasive species in other parts of the world, including New Zealand and parts of Asia. These spiders are highly adaptable and thrive in urban and rural areas alike. You&amp;#039;ll often find them hiding in sheltered locations such as garden sheds, under outdoor furniture or even in mailboxes. What Attracts and Deters Redback Spiders? Redback spiders are attracted to environments with abundant prey and sheltered areas for web-building. Their diet includes insects and even small vertebrates that get caught in their webs. The female&amp;#039;s web is irregular and sticky, designed to trap prey while providing a hiding spot for the spider. Male redback spiders often venture into the female&amp;#039;s web during mating season, making these sites even busier.
